| Designers name their favourite fashion flowers | |
| Written by Samantha Critchell, AP Fashion Writer | |
| March 17, 2010 - Along with crocuses and daffodils comes another surefire sign of spring: florals in fashion. The garden-party look is a seasonal classic, but there's been some updating this season. Twists include tulip-style hemlines and fabric petals adorning everything from tank tops to ballgowns.
